diff options
author | Igor Scheller <igor.scheller@igorshp.de> | 2017-08-31 12:25:06 +0200 |
---|---|---|
committer | Igor Scheller <igor.scheller@igorshp.de> | 2017-08-31 12:32:08 +0200 |
commit | 0a20883aa862779b48fd2a297456c2db04cffb95 (patch) | |
tree | 310600aaa23404f0cd7d3e198bacdbc93645da32 /includes/view | |
parent | 2bd127c011846aad69731d1d63535a3d4f100af0 (diff) |
Reimplementation of 2840bb619 (signup requires arrival), closes #330
Diffstat (limited to 'includes/view')
-rw-r--r-- | includes/view/Rooms_view.php |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/includes/view/Rooms_view.php b/includes/view/Rooms_view.php index 3c0440a4..adb58a9a 100644 --- a/includes/view/Rooms_view.php +++ b/includes/view/Rooms_view.php @@ -11,8 +11,16 @@ use Engelsystem\ShiftsFilterRenderer; */ function Room_view($room, ShiftsFilterRenderer $shiftsFilterRenderer, ShiftCalendarRenderer $shiftCalendarRenderer) { + global $user; + + $assignNotice = ''; + if (config('signup_requires_arrival') && !$user['Gekommen']) { + $assignNotice = info(render_user_arrived_hint(), true); + } + return page_with_title(glyph('map-marker') . $room['Name'], [ $shiftsFilterRenderer->render($room), + $assignNotice, $shiftCalendarRenderer->render() ]); } |